  1. Web Map Service (WMS)

    Web Map Service (WMS) is a standard protocol used to serve georeferenced map images over the internet. It allows users to access maps as dynamic images, and enables clients to request and receive map images from a WMS server. The WMS server then generates and returns map images in the requested format, projection, and scale.   3. Web Map Tile Service (WMTS)

    Web Map Tile Service (WMTS) is a standard protocol for serving pre-rendered map tiles over the internet. It provides a way to distribute map data in a tile-based format, allowing users to view and interact with maps in a fast and efficient manner. WMTS divides maps into small rectangular tiles at different zoom levels, and these tiles are requested by clients to create a seamless map display. The tiles are typically cached on the client side, enabling quick retrieval and rendering of map data. WMTS supports various map projections and allows for the customization of map styles and layers.   4. National Transfer Format (NTF)

    The National Transfer Format (NTF) is a standardized data format used in the UK for exchanging geographic data. It allows for the transfer of map data between different systems and applications, preserving accuracy and integrity.   7. Web Feature Service (WFS)

    Web Feature Service (WFS) is an open standard developed by the Open Geospatial Consortium (OGC) for publishing and sharing geospatial vector data over the internet. It allows clients to access and retrieve geospatial features, such as points, lines, and polygons, from a server and perform operations like querying, filtering, and editing.   10. Esri Grid

    Esri Grid is a binary raster file format used for representing continuous data such as elevation, temperature, and precipitation, developed by Esri for use in their ArcGIS software. It consists of a header file and a binary data file, and supports single and multi-band data, as well as compression.
